As soon as I saw this super cute image by designer Cheryl Alger I thought of the anchor on a large ship and the captain shouting 'Ahoy there' so just had to use those things. The anchor itself was an svg I got from Aymee over at A Southernbelle's SVG's which I resized, I then added the chain effect links which I made in SCAL2 out of seperate rectangles, to give a little more effect to my card. The words Ahoy and birthday boy were cut using SCAL2 also with the font 'Hobo BT'. All the pieces were shadowed and raised on foam pads. I coloured my little 'Sailor Boy' with Promarkers and then mounted the top of him with foam pads and the bottom stuck down flat to give definition.
